Highlights of Studying South Champagne Business School in France

  • Human-size business school with 1,000 students and 300 overseas students on campus.

  • 95% of the graduates find jobs within four months of course completion.

  • 40 dual degrees.

  • An average annual salary of 34,000 EUR.

  • 40 nationalities are represented on campus.

  • 149 partner universities in 41 nations and five continents.

  • Programs delivered 100% in English.

  • A business incubator called Young Entrepreneur Centre.

  • 18 permanent lecturers, 17 lecturer-researchers, and 60 external or visiting lecturers.

  • International students get the option to take French language classes.

South Champagne Business School

South Champagne Business School is a State recognized higher education institute in France. The Aube General Council, Grand Est region, the Chamber of Commerce and Industry of the Aube and Troyes, and the Troyes Champagne Metropole support it. An active Conférence des Grandes Ecoles member, SCBS offers top-quality management study programs at undergraduate and postgraduate levels. The school regularly operates on strong human principles, like diversity and innovation. It strongly believes that regardless of cultural and social origin, students can find study programs that suit their education requirements and give them the scope to build a great career.

South Champagne Business School is also a part of the Y Schools management ecosystem that includes a total of 10 vocational and initial educational institutes, likeÉcole Supérieure de Tourisme (School of Tourism), Écoles de la 2e Chance (Second Chance Schools) and École Supérieure de Design (School of Design).

Campuses of South Champagne Business School

South Champagne Business School features four campuses in Troyes, Chaumont, Yaoundé, and Charleville-Mézières. The Troyes campus of SCBS boasts many trainees and students from various entities and schools in the Y Schools ecosystem. The campus offers the best environments for students to study and develop their careers. The Troyes campus of SCBS features

  • La Rue: A hot spot for students with a central bar for several events, reception, and several entertainment areas like a video games console, piano, and table tennis. It even features areas for discussion and relaxation.
  • University restaurant
  • 1 K'fet
  • Y Lab is a 360-degree documentary resource center with more than 11,000 documents.
  • Nine amphitheaters with a maximum of 150 seats
  • Six multimedia rooms
  • L’Arène: a circular amphitheater with 500 seats
  • One multisport pitch and a sports hall
  • Patios
  • Societies and clubs with relaxation and meeting areas for students
  • Secure Parking
  • Catering areas

The Charleville-Mézières and Chaumont campuses of the South Champagne Business School have offered the Global Bachelor of Management program since 2020 in partnership with the Conurbation of Chaumont, the Departmental Council, and the GIP Haute-Marne along with the Ardenne Metropole respectively.

The Yaoundé campus of SCBS is called EIME: International School of Management and Entrepreneurship. The school offers a 3-year Bachelor's degree in Business Management and has approximately 180 students over the three years duration of this course. The main purpose of the International School of Management and Entrepreneurship is to train future entrepreneurs and managers for the realities of business.

Postgraduate at South Champagne Business School

The Grand École Programs Master Degree in Management is the main master's program at South Champagne Business School. Accessible through an entrance examination after completing 2 or 3 years of higher studies, this master's degree in South Champagne Business School offers several specializations and tracks, such as design, entrepreneurship, marketing, and finance.

This program teaches students to keep an open mind, think outside the box, take on the world, and become one of the most celebrated actors of the future. A few reasons to enroll for a master's at South Champagne Business School are:

  • National dual degree in collaboration with Troyes EPF engineering school.
  • Design and Management Strategy track in partnership with Troyes School of Design.
  • 360 months of studies abroad with 90 partner universities across the world.
  • 11 to 20 months of work placement
  • 10 dual degrees in France and international destinations like Austria, Germany, Indonesia, Spain, Latvia, Italy, Russia, Poland, and Morocco.

Nine majors are available with this master's program at SCBS:

  • Design & Management Strategy
  • Event & Sports Management
  • Global Human Resources Management
  • Supply Chain Management
  • Banking for Business
  • Marketing & International Sales Development
  • Digital Marketing & Social Media
  • Audit & Management Control
  • Master of Science Innovation, Creativity & Entrepreneurship

MSc ICE, or Master of Science in Innovation, Creativity & Entrepreneurship, is yet another high-level master's program at SCBS focusing on innovation and entrepreneurship. It is delivered entirely in English and brings designers, engineers, and managers together. This is a 15-month multidisciplinary program that features 40 students per cohort, and its syllabus is a mix of design, management, and engineering topics. The students learn through personalized coaching and real business assignments under entrepreneurial teams and are sure to find jobs after course completion.

South Champagne Business School also offers Specialized Masters in Performance Management and Industrial Transformation. This master's program prepares managers to handle the global transformation of information, management, and production models towards more responsive and agile models. This master's program at SCBS originates from the well-known expertise of two business schools, the SCBS and the Troyes University of Technology, in collaboration with management experts and industry specialist lecturers. 20% of the teaching in this study program is dedicated to CSR issues, and it is perfect for the work-study of students from overseas destinations.

Postgraduate Entry Requirement at South Champagne Business School

The entry requirement for a master's in South Champagne Business School is 2, 3, or 4 years of higher studies. Students seeking entry into this course also need to sit for an internal entrance examination. It is also essential for applicants to hold an international bachelor's degree to take up master's programs at SCBS. For entry into Specialized Masters in Performance Management and Industrial Transformation, students must take an entrance examination at SCBS and hold one of the following qualifications:

  • Degree from a school of management authorized to offer Masters grade (CEFDG list).
  • Engineering degree with Commission des Titres d’Ingénieur authorization (CTI list).
  • M1 degree or equivalent for all auditors with minimum 3 years of professional experience in business intelligence.
  • 3rd cycle degree with authorization by university entities, like DESS, DEA, and Masters or vocational qualification equivalent to a postgraduate degree of 5 years.
  • Overseas degree equivalent to a French postgraduate degree.
  • Qualification listed with RNCP level 1.

Postgraduate Tuition Fee in South Champagne Business School for International Students

The master's degree course fee at South Champagne Business School is affordable. Postgraduate programs tuition fees at South Champagne Business School are made more affordable with the availability of scholarships and grants. The Master's Programs tuition fee at South Champagne Business School does not include living expenses and the cost of transportation. The tuition fee at South Champagne Business School is also subject to change every year.

DEGREE

TUITION FEE FOR INTERNATIONAL STUDENTS

DURATION

Grande École Program Master Degree in Management 9,500 EUR 1 Year
Grande École Program Master Degree in Management 10,500 EUR 2 Years
Specialized Masters in Performance Management and Industrial Transformation 9,500 EUR for Job Seekers and Students

15,500 EUR for Employees and Companies

Undergraduate at South Champagne Business School

Global Bachelor in Management is the main Bachelor program at South Champagne Business School. This is a 3-year Bachelor's degree in South Champagne Business School delivered in French. With this Bachelor's in South Champagne Business School, students can achieve entrepreneurship skills and the knowledge required to manage company projects or develop sectors, products, profit centers, and suppliers' portfolios.

Students who complete their undergraduate at SCBS can continue their studies at the Master's Level. This study program trains managers likely to work in different mid-caps or SMEs, start-up business contexts, and multinational companies. Graduates acquire cross-cutting skills that help them work at the most relevant and current professional standards to take up business challenges, like sales development, innovation, communication, and digital transformation. This further helps them find jobs quickly.

Students can enroll in the 1st year after leaving school, in the 2nd year after one year of higher studies, and in the 3rd year after two years of higher studies. The third year of this study program is delivered in two tracks: a work-study track and a full-time track. Some reasons to enroll in the Bachelor's program at SCBS are:

  • Functional and spacious campus with several relaxation areas to offer students an incomparable experience.
  • 13 to 15 months of work placement in France or any other international destination.
  • 3-year degree program certified by the Ministry of Higher Education and Research.

The South Champagne Business School also offers International Bachelor in Business Administration, a 4-year BBA program leading to a State-certified degree. This BBA program offers dual language tracks for the first two years: the all-in-English track and the French-speaking program. The 4th year classes are conducted in both English and French.

Undergraduate Entry Requirement for International Students in South Champagne Business School

The entry requirement for a bachelor's in South Champagne Business School is one year of studies in France for international students. Overseas students opting for this program also need to hold a student residence permit to be eligible for the work-study format of this program. They must also sit for an entrance examination accessible with an international baccalaureate or after 1 or 2 years of higher studies. Undergraduate Tuition Fee in South Champagne Business School

South Champagne Business School is recognized by the Ministry of Higher Education and Research and Innovation as a private higher studies institute of general interest. The Bachelor's degree course fee in South Champagne Business School shows the institute implementing a policy of social openness. The undergraduate programs tuition fee at South Champagne Business School does not include any living or transportation expenses. One of the best things about the Bachelor's program's tuition fee at South Champagne Business School is that it remains fixed for the entire course duration.

DEGREE

TUITION FEE FOR INTERNATIONAL STUDENTS

DURATION

Global Bachelor in Management 8,300 EUR -
International Bachelor in Business Administration 9,000 EUR 1 Year
International Bachelor in Business Administration 9,550 EUR 2 Years

Research at South Champagne Business School

Ph.D. programs in South Champagne Business School are in perfect line with the institute's mission and the local challenges of development of the Troyes economic area. Research at SCBS focuses on pedagogy and teaching. The institute has always chosen to align its research with the requirements for skills in four main educational departments: Economy & Finance, Marketing & Organisation, Strategic Management, and Innovation & Entrepreneurship.

FAQ:


Does South Champagne Business School organize corporate or recruitment events for its students?

Yes, it does. The recruitment events of the school help students explore fields of activity, companies, expertise, and jobs. These events also help them find suitable work placements and create a network of professionals.


What is job dating at SCBS?

SCBS, in collaboration with its partner McArthur Glen, offers lucrative jobs to the students in Glen stores at weekends and during Sales periods. This is called job dating at SCBS.


How do SCBS partners contribute to the well-being of the students?

SCBS partners work alongside the institute to create study programs in perfect line with market expectations. The partners also entrust SCBS with educational assignments to offer students the experience of working in real situations.


Which are the partner companies of SCBS?

Reputable partner companies of SCBS include MisterFly, Generali, Century 21, Optic 2000, Amadeus, Easy Voyage, and Enedis.


What about work placements at SCBS?

Work placements are available with all the undergraduate and postgraduate courses at SCBS. These are for more than two months, making the students eligible for payments by the host organization.
